Matthew Pauley

Matthew Pauley

Matthew is a Managing Director with over two decades of experience in the financial services industry primarily focused on covering the Financial Sponsor sector. He specializes in business development having sourced, financed, or advised on over 50 capital market or M&A transactions in his career.

With Accordion, Matthew works with the Business Development team, helping Accordion build out and strengthen their Private Equity sponsor relationships and ensuring that all aspects of Accordion’s services are delivered seamlessly to their portfolio companies.

Prior to joining Accordion, Matthew spent more than two decades in Financial Services and investment banking. He was previously a Managing Director with WhiteHawk Capital Partners a direct lending fund. There, he was responsible for business development – sourcing and structuring new lending transactions to deploy assets.

Prior to WhiteHawk, Matthew worked with the Sponsor Coverage teams at Capital One and GE Antares. He was responsible for relationship coverage for West Coast based Private Equity Sponsor coverage including Ares Management, Oaktree Capital, and Aurora Capital among others.

Matthew began his career in investment banking at Bank of America Securities and then at Bear Stearns, & Co. covering the consumer, restaurant, retail, and casino gaming industries where he gained extensive analytical and transaction experience in M&A, capital markets and leveraged finance.

Matthew graduated from The Anderson School at UCLA with an M.B.A. and from Middlebury College with a Bachelor of Arts degree in Economics.
